Output 68c3ba4c17754f428f833b8aceee12f518c1f7ce90114934f1e380b07aad3cd8:3

value
18840124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b5e8f65d3a269ef4bf1596e36727cdc6e39187b OP_EQUAL
address
35eLFwrvnq58wjdWSH3S7QeD8Mm3ev6ktC
transaction
68c3ba4c17754f428f833b8aceee12f518c1f7ce90114934f1e380b07aad3cd8
spent
true